Active ingredients

The drug STERINAF contains one active pharmaceutical ingredient (API):

1 Sodium fluoride ¹⁸F
UNII 9L75099X6R - SODIUM FLUORIDE F-18

Sodium fluoride F18 is a radioactive diagnostic agent for positron emission tomography (PET) indicated for imaging of bone to define areas of altered osteogenic activity. Increased fluoride F18 ion deposition in bone can occur in areas of increased osteogenic activity during growth, infection, malignancy (primary or metastatic) following trauma, or inflammation of bone.

Medicine classification

This drug has been classified in the anatomical therapeutic chemical (ATC) classification system as follows:

ATC code Group title Classification
V09IX06 V Various → V09 Diagnostic radiopharmaceuticals → V09I Tumour detection → V09IX Other diagnostic radiopharmaceuticals for tumour detection
